A recombinant vaccine against herpes zoster (Shingrix) did not increase short‑term disease flares and had an acceptable short-term safety profile in patients with autoimmune rheumatic diseases.

Uptake of the recombinant zoster vaccine (RZV) among adults with rheumatic diseases in the 20 months following the updated 2021 recommendations ranged from 7% to just more than 10% across conditions.
